The online lottery is a form of gambling that involves playing games wherein a person pays money for a chance to win a prize. The odds of winning vary from game to game. The most popular games are Powerball, Mega Millions and Keno. Online lotteries also offer different types of scratch-off tickets and a number of instant-win games.

The US lottery industry is highly regulated by state governments. Some states have their own lottery websites while others contract out the management of their sites to third-party vendors. These companies are licensed and regulated by the gaming commissions. They should have a secure website and a dedicated customer support team. The popularity of the internet and mobile devices has made it possible for people to buy lottery tickets from their homes, workplaces, football stadiums or local pubs. It has also reduced the cost of playing the lottery by making it cheaper to buy a ticket online. Previously, it was only possible to purchase a lottery ticket by visiting an official retailer.
